使用csv.writer()函数创建一个CSV写入器对象,该对象将用于将数据写入CSV文件。 python writer = csv.writer(file) 4. 遍历列表,将每个元素写入csv文件 如果列表是一个二维列表(即列表的每个元素也是一个列表,代表CSV文件的一行),可以直接使用writer.writerows()方法一次性写入所有行。如果列表是一维的,需要将其转...
trydf.to_csv('df1.csv', index=False, encoding='gbk', mode='a') 按列追加运行结果结果: 3、反例(没转字典就只有一列) 如果把每个列表仅转换成DataFrame类型数据,追加写入csv,会发现写入都是在整列后面写入 如下演示: week1 = ['一', '二', '三', '四', '五', '六', '七'] weekSpend =...
写入列表数据:使用CSV写入器的writerow()方法将列表作为一行数据写入到CSV文件中。例如,如果要将['value1', 'value2', 'value3']作为一行写入,可以使用writer.writerow(['value1', 'value2', 'value3'])。 关闭CSV文件:使用close()方法关闭CSV文件,以释放系统资源。 下面是一个完整的示例代码: 代...
要将列表插入CSV文件,首先需要导入csv模块,然后使用csv.writer类创建一个写入器对象。接下来,可以使用写入器对象的writerow方法将列表中的数据写入CSV文件中的一行。 以下是一个示例代码,演示如何使用Python将列表插入CSV文件: 代码语言:txt 复制 import csv data = [['Name', 'Age', 'City'], ['John', 28,...
步骤1:创建一个列表 首先,我们需要创建一个列表,其中包含需要写入CSV文件的数据。假设我们要写入一个包含学生姓名和年龄的列表数据: data=[['Alice',18],['Bob',20],['Charlie',22]] 1. 这里我们创建了一个名为data的列表,其中每个元素都是一个包含姓名和年龄的子列表。
通过writer.writerow()方法将数字列表中的每个元素写入CSV文件的一行。 fornumberindata:writer.writerow([number]) 1. 2. 5. 关闭文件 在完成数据写入后,记得关闭文件,释放资源。 file.close() 1. 总结 通过以上步骤,我们成功实现了将数字列表写入CSV文件的功能。希望这篇文章对于刚入行的小白有所帮助,让你能...
最常见的操作就是读取和写入。(1)从csv文件中读取内容现在我们来读取上面的info.csv文件内容。现在VS CODE 中新建一个cell,导入csv模块import csv要读取 CSV 文件,我们需要用到 CSV 模块中的 DictReader 类,DictReader 可以将每一行以字典的形式读出来,key 就是表头,value 就是对应单元格的内容。
在Python中,将列表数据写入CSV文件是一种常见的需求。使用pandas库可以轻松实现这一目标。首先,导入pandas库,并定义两个列表a和b。接着,创建一个DataFrame对象,其中列名分别为'a_name'和'b_name',对应的值分别为a和b。最后,利用DataFrame的to_csv方法将数据写入名为"test.csv"的文件中,并设置...
import csv #python2可以用file替代open with open("test.csv","w")ascsvfile: writer=csv.writer(csvfile) #先写入columns_name writer.writerow(["index","a_name","b_name"]) #写入多行用writerows writer.writerows([[0,1,3],[1,2,3],[2,3,4]]) ...